Physical Benefits of Scooter Riding


Beyond the excitement and social opportunities, riding a scooter also provides numerous physical benefits. Scooting is a great way for kids to exercise without it feeling like work. It encourages the use of multiple muscle groups as they push off the ground with their feet, steer through turns, and maintain balance. Engaging in regular scooter rides helps strengthen their legs, arms, and core muscles, promoting overall physical fitness.


Moreover, scooting is excellent for developing coordination and balance. Children learn to navigate their environment, manage speed, and avoid obstacles, all of which are crucial skills for their physical development. As they grow more adept at riding, they'll gain confidence in their physical abilities, paving the way for future sports and active pursuits.

Safety First Ensuring a Secure Riding Experience


While the joy of scooting is undeniable, safety should always be a priority. Parents and caregivers must ensure that young riders are equipped with proper safety gear. Helmets, knee pads, and elbow pads can significantly reduce the risk of injuries, making the scooting experience safe and enjoyable. It's also vital to teach kids about road safety, such as looking both ways before crossing streets and being aware of their surroundings.


Choosing the right scooter is equally crucial. There are various types available, tailored to different age groups and sizes. A properly sized scooter not only enhances the riding experience but also ensures that the child can operate it safely and effectively. Parents should consider factors like the scooter's weight, handlebar height, and wheel size when selecting the perfect scooter for their little ones.
